California Whipple (who hates her name and soon changes it to Lucy) has been dragged from her beloved home is Massachusetts when her widowed mother decides to live out the dream she and her late husband had of going west. When California Morning Whipple's widowed mother uproots her family from their comfortable Massachusetts environs and moves them to a rough mining camp called Lucky Diggins in the Sierras, California Morning resents the upheaval. THE BALLAD OF LUCY WHIPPLE by Karen Cushman ‧ RELEASE DATE: Aug. 16, 1996 The recent Newbery medalist plunks down two more strong-minded women, this time in an 1849 mining camp—a milieu far removed from the Middle Ages of her first novels, but not all that different when it comes to living standards.
